Complete Buying Guide for Personal Carry On Bags

Essential Factors We Consider

When selecting the best personal carry on bags for flying, we prioritize size, organization, and durability. Always check your specific airline’s dimensions, as they can vary between budget carriers and full-service airlines. A good bag should have plenty of pockets to keep your items separated, saving you from digging around mid-flight.

Budget Planning

Investing in a high-quality personal item can save you hundreds of dollars in baggage fees over just a few trips. We recommend looking for a balance between price and feature set. While budget options like the ECOHUB pack are fantastic, consider if the extra features like built-in packing cubes or waterproof materials in the pricier models provide more long-term value for your specific travel needs.

Q: What is a personal item versus a carry-on?

A: A personal item is typically smaller and must fit underneath the seat in front of you, whereas a carry-on bag is usually larger and is stored in the overhead bin. Always check with your airline to confirm their exact size limits for personal items.
